OVERVIEW:
What is the gastrin level fasting (serum) lab test?
Gastrin level fasting serum lab test is a blood test that checks for excess gastrin hormone production in the body.
Why is the gastrin level fasting serum lab test done?
Gastrin level fasting serum lab test is done in order to:
- Detect excess gastrin production,
- Diagnose Zollinger-Ellison syndrome (excess acid production in the stomach due to tumors),
- Diagnose gastrinomas (gastrin producing tumors),
- Diagnose G-cell hyperplasia (increase in the number of G cells),
- Monitor the recurrence of a gastrinoma (gastrin producing tumor).
